Take him to a reproduction / fertility specialist vet & get him fertility tested. It's a simple procedure & will tell you how good his fertlilty is  :)

If he is only 12 months old then you shouldn't have used him yet as he won't have been old enough to have his Hips scored until 12 months and the results often take up to 6 weeks to come back.

If he has already been used foru times what age was he first time.  such a big breed will be less mature than a smaller one at that age.  How far apart where the matings?

Our imorted boy was used for the first time at 14 months then a couple of monts later so had sired 3 litters in the first year then 3 litters in his second.  Hoping for  a first litter from him this year in July, and he has two other bitches booked. 

Sounds like he has been used too often too young, and without health tests to boot is most irresponsible.
